The ambition for the 19th edition of the FIBA Women’s Basketball World Cup 2022 (FWBWC2022) was to deliver the most sustainable event since inception and create a Sustainability Blueprint Framework from the learnings for future major and mega events as a part of Legacy.
Melissa King, Chief Executive of the Local Organising Committee announced today that the post event materiality assessment has been completed by Pangolin Associates who found the event created unavoidable emissions of 14,062 tonnes of CO2 equivalent. The LOC has purchased the equivalent offsets through verified and impactful carbon offsets projects to deliver a carbon neutral event.
“We could not have achieved this without the contributions from ticket buyers, the International Federation (FIBA), Australian Government, participating Team Delegations, our staff and volunteers.”
Minister For Sport, Anika Wells said “The Australian Government proudly supported the FIBA Women’s Basketball World Cup, which exceeded expectations.
“Being a carbon neutral event is an outstanding achievement and the development of the Sustainable Event Blueprint will be an important legacy for future events during the Green and Gold Decade.”
